Pagini recente » Cod sursa (job #2845693) | Cod sursa (job #521986) | Cod sursa (job #1062506) | Cod sursa (job #2593185) | Cod sursa (job #1108962)
#include <cstdio>
#define FILEIN "aprindere.in"
#define FILEOUT "aprindere.out"
#define NMAX 1005
bool On[NMAX];
int main() {
freopen(FILEIN, "r", stdin);
freopen(FILEOUT, "w", stdout);
int n, m, sol = 0;
scanf("%d %d", &n, &m);
for ( int i = 1; i <= n; i++ ) {
scanf("%d", &On[i]);
}
for ( int i = 1, c, t, nr; i <= m; i++ ) {
scanf("%d %d %d", &c, &t, &nr);
bool status = On[c+1];
if (!status)
sol = sol + t;
for ( int i = 1, k; i <= nr; i++ ) {
scanf("%d", &k);
if (!status)
On[k+1] = !On[k+1];
}
}
printf("%d\n", sol);
return 0;
}